**SDK parity (Driftlane onboarding):** The Kestrel-JS and Kestrel-Swift SDKs are expected to stay feature-equivalent each release. The parity matrix in the wiki tracks gaps; currently Swift lacks offline queue flushing, targeted for next sprint. When you cut an SDK release, both packages must ship together and pass the parity test suite. Artifacts won't publish until they're signed by the release pipeline, which expects the team's current signing key, reproduced below for convenience.

deploy key for kahof-tadup: bky4_rRMZ

MEMO — Records Team, Hartwell Provisions Ltd.

The Q3 stock-count ledger for the Dunmore Lane warehouse has been reconciled against the bin-card totals and signed off by both counters. All variances above two units are annotated in the margin column per standard practice. The bound original must travel to the Kellerman Street archive by courier this Thursday. The confidential hand-over instruction for the courier follows below.

courier memo of tawep-tajep: the quenius ulaiel courier leaves the fenir ledger at gate 9128 under passcode 527513

## Tuning

The Gravelhorn profile store shards by a consistent hash of the account key. Resharding is online but expensive, so pick shard counts that leave room for growth — doubling is the only supported split. Hot-key mitigation relies on the read-replica fanout, not more shards. If latency climbs, tune replica fanout and cache TTL first. The defaults that ship with the service are as follows.

tuning table, hafog-bahaf:
QUOTAS = {
    "praion": 144,
    "briax": 906,
    "silwyn": 451,
}